Abstract

The invention discloses acid cycle battery formation equipment and method. The equipment comprises an acid liquor storage device, an acid liquor conveying cycle system, an acid liquor cooling system,an acid liquor detection system, a charging system and an electric control system; the acid liquor storage device is used for dispensing acid and storing the acid liquor; the acid liquor detection system is arranged in the acid liquor storage device and used for detecting the acid liquor in real time; the acid liquor cooling system is arranged in the acid liquor conveying system and used for cooling the acid liquor; the acid liquor conveying cycle system is used for conveying the acid liquor in the acid liquor storage device to the charging system; a plurality of electric valves is arranged inthe acid liquor conveying cycle system, and the on-off and flow of each electric valve are controlled through an electric control system; and the charging system is connected with a to-be-charged battery through a connector. The method comprises the following steps: preparing low-density acid, cycling the low-density acid, switching the low-density acid to the high-density acid, charging and halting. The equipment disclosed by the invention is short in system pipeline, fast in acid liquor preparing, and stable in charging.

Description

technical field [0001] The invention relates to acid cycle battery formation equipment and methods, and belongs to the technical field of battery charging equipment. Background technique [0002] Lead-acid batteries are widely favored by the market because of their favorable price. However, the charging process of lead-acid batteries is the core of technology. Traditional lead-acid batteries need to consume a lot of water when charging, and the deployment of acid solution is completed in a separate workshop. After being prepared, it is transported to the charging system through pipelines. The pipeline is long and the parameters of the acid solution cannot be accurately controlled, which are all technical problems.
